Job Description
Working within the Town Planning and Consenting function, you'll coordinate the implementation of complex consenting strategies across both Town and Country Planning Act (TCPA) and Development Consent Order (DCO) regimes. This role requires a confident communicator and skilled programme manager, capable of aligning technical inputs, managing stakeholders, and maintaining control of project timelines. With a strong on-site presence and a commitment to a multi-year assignment, you'll help ensure our major projects secure the consents they need to move forward.
Responsibilities
* Working closely with internal HAL teams and external consultants/stakeholders to facilitate constructive dialogue, address concerns, and obtain necessary data and approvals in a timely manner.
* Maintaining accurate records of progress and milestones and preparing comprehensive reports to support project documentation and compliance requirements.
* Conducting risk assessments to identify potential barriers to progress and developing mitigation strategies to address challenges proactively.
* Collaborating with consenting consultants, designers, engineers, project managers, and other stakeholders to integrate consent requirements into project plans and schedules, ensuring alignment with project objectives and timelines.
* Identifying opportunities for process improvement, streamlining consents management processes, and implementing best practices to enhance efficiency and effectiveness.
* Working with multidisciplinary teams such as Planning, Socioeconomics, Environmental Impact Assessment, Surface Access, Land and Property, Consultation and Engagement, Design and Engineering, Delivery, Masterplanning, Legal, etc., to share knowledge, provide guidance, and foster a culture of collaboration and excellence.
Qualifications
* Good understanding of the processes and stages involved in TCPA and DCO regimes.
* Project management skills, including task prioritization, managing competing deadlines, and coordinating activities across multiple fronts.
* Analytical mindset with the ability to assess complex regulatory requirements, identify potential risks, and develop pragmatic solutions.
*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to build positive relationships with stakeholders and negotiate effectively.
Ideally, you'll have:
* Experience managing and progressing large-scale consenting applications (DCO and aviation sector experience is desirable).
* Recognised professional qualifications, e.g., APM, PRINCE, MRTPI, MRICS, MCIOB, etc.
